The iSpring RCC7P-AK is a 6-stage reverse osmosis system designed for homes with low water pressure, featuring a built-in booster pump and alkaline remineralization. It effectively removes over 1,000 contaminants, including lead and PFAS, while restoring beneficial minerals. It is best suited for households with 4+ people or those prioritizing mineral-balanced drinking water.

The Express Water 100 GPD system is a multi-stage under-sink water filtration unit that integrates reverse osmosis, UV sterilization, and alkaline mineralization to remove up to 99.99% of contaminants. It offers comprehensive purification for large households, though the slow flow rate and space requirements are notable trade-offs. It is best suited for large households (8+ people) seeking comprehensive water purification.

Professional sources consistently highlight the iSpring RCC7P-AK as a maximum performance option in its category. Reviewers specifically praise the addition of the booster pump and alkaline remineralization as distinguishing features that address common reverse osmosis system shortcomings, such as low flow in low-pressure homes and acidic water production.
Everyday users report noticeable taste improvements after three months of use, describing the water as having a smooth, slightly sweet profile that feels healthier than tap water. Common praise includes reliable daily performance for essential household needs and the booster pump operating nearly inaudibly.

Professional reviews are limited, but the product carries NSF certification for its reverse osmosis components, validating its contaminant reduction claims. The system is distinguished by its triple-technology approach, integrating UV sterilization and alkaline mineralization with standard RO filtration, placing it in the premium category for comprehensive purification.
Users generally rate the system highly, praising its ability to produce clean, great-tasting water and its comprehensive filtration capabilities. The automatic leak detection and easy installation are frequently highlighted positives.
